Buie Rectal Aspiration Curette

Buie Rectal Aspiration Curette is a specialized device that gastroenterology surgeons use in conjunction with a proctoscope or rectoscope, in order to suction foreign bodies, abnormal mucosa and other materials during haemorrhoidal ligation.

  • Angled Profile for Reaching Deep Spaces.
  • Finger Cut-Off Valve to Control Aspiration.
  • Distal Hub Ensuring Optimal System Connection.


SKU:1f4a2a8005b1

The Buie Rectal Aspiration Curette offers a wide range of surgical benefits. Its principal use is to provide an atraumatic way to access the anal and rectal canal through a rectoscope and aspire fluids or tissue.

For this purpose, the instrument features a hollow, slim tube with an angled profile to reach deep areas of the lower digestive tract. In addition, the tip of the tube has suction to ports for multi-directional aspiration. Also, the 3.3mm diameter is ideal to pass into narrow passages.

Moreover, the Biue Rectal Aspiration Curette features a finger cut-off valve to control aspiration with ease. Additionally, the device has a bottom hub that serves as a connection point with the suction system.

Manufactured in premium grade stainless steel to ensure the highest quality instruments in your operating rooms.
